AxetrisModel EMIRS 200 -Powerfull and Scalable Broadband Infrared Source

SHARE
The Axetris EMIRS200 infrared source is available in different versions and is suitable for various sensor principles: For example, non-dispersive infrared spectroscopy (NDIR), photoacoustic spectroscopy (PAS), and attenuated total reflection spectroscopy (ATR). Common applications are environmental measurement, medical diagnostics, and safety applications in industry. The collimation properties of Axetris infrared sources are well-suited to many optical designs and detector characteristics in terms of the angular distribution of radiation. Their compact size makes them easy to integrate into most solutions. EMIRS200 infrared sources are available and compatible with a variety of broadband optical filters.

  • True black body radiation
  • High modulation depth
  • High electrical-optical efficiency
  • Long lifetime
  • Typical current at 460°C: 75 mA
  • Typical voltage at 460°C: 5.2 V
  • Broadband emission power: 28 mW
  • Package Type: TO-39
  • Broadband window: No
  • Buildup: TO Cap
  • Emissivity: 0.85 ε
  • IRS Chip: EMIRS200
  • Lifetime: 10 a
  • Max. peak temperature: 500 °C
  • Medium cold resistance: 45 Ω
  • Medium hot resistance: 72 Ω
  • Modulation depth at 20Hz: 0.8
  • Modulation depth at 50Hz: 0.5
  • Sealing type: Front vent
  • Working temperature: 460 °C
  • Country of origin: Switzerland
